## Ledger integrity check — Ember Points

Run the reconciliation job before and after any schema change. All writes go through the append-only ledger; direct table edits are forbidden and audited. Points adjustments above the daily cap require dual approval. If drift exceeds tolerance, freeze redemptions and page the data owner. Verify the job runs under the restricted service account. The enforcement thresholds and audit settings are as follows.

service settings:
PRAIX_LOG_LEVEL=error
PRAIX_METRICS_HOST=metrics.praix.qorvelcorp.corp
PRAIX_POOL_SIZE=16

Attendees: sales leads, commercial director.

The proposed venture with Orvandel Logistics was reviewed. Margins on the shared distribution corridor through Penhallow look acceptable; governance split remains 60/40 pending negotiation. Sales leads raised concerns about channel conflict with the Astermere accounts, to be resolved before signature. A term sheet draft is expected within two weeks. Minutes approved by the chair. The confidential note on forward business plans appears directly below.

board note of bawep-tajef: Queniusek Systems plans to raise the Quenvan list price by 53.1 percent in March. The pricing group signed off on a budget of $176.4 million for Project Drueth. The renewal with Casionix Partners closes at $142.5 million a year, 8.3 percent below the last contract. Project Fraax slips by six weeks because of the tooling delay.

**09:41** — Plugin authors began reporting delayed notification deliveries from the Larkmont fan-out service. Root cause: a burst of high-priority broadcasts filled the outbound queue, and the backpressure controller throttled all plugin webhooks rather than only the saturated partition. Deliveries were delayed up to twelve minutes; none were dropped. We deployed a fix scoping throttling per partition, and plugin retries drained normally by 10:15. If your plugin logged timeouts in this window, correlate them against the build token below.

session token of tajef-bageg = htk21_5d90d574934f3ccae6437